摘要

Abstract

The damage of VFTO to the equipment increases with the increase of the rated voltage,and the suppression of VFTO is of great importance to guarantee the safe operation of the equipment of the GIS substation.Bus design thought,this paper puts forward a kind of damping of the damper bus consists of hollow out solenoid and parallel with the resistance,under power frequency,the insulation performance of busbar,flow capacity and mechanical properties of impact,under the high frequency,the traveling wave current form high voltage through the inductor,the wave energy can be absorbed by the two end damping resistors under the high voltage.This paper set up a typical 550 kV GIS station VFTO calculation model,the analysis of the VFTO situation of the main nodes of the substation are analyzed under the cases of the 550 kV GIS substation maintenance turns 40 kinds of operating mode under the eight kinds of running condition,the distribution diagram of the maximum VFTO generated by disconnector operation is obtained.According to the largest VFTO amplitude distribution of busbar equipped with damping,by the calculation,high amplitude VFTO produced by isolating switch operation times is significantly reduced,site VFTO most large amplitude reduced from 3.0 p.u.to 2.2 p.u.,and bus bar Ⅰ right end of 3.0 p.u.amplitude reduced to 1.4 p.u..In this paper,the research results show that the damping bus can effectively reduce the VFTO amplitude and frequency,to reduce caused by VFTO GIS internal equipment,external connection equipment and secondary equipment safety issues have a significant effect.
